What you will need
This recipe uses 5 simple ingredients that you can find at any grocery store:
- 1 cup white grape juice
- 1 cup lemon-lime soda
- 3 tablespoons grenadine syrup
- 4 drops blue food coloring
- 1 cup ice cubes
Step by step instructions
Step 1: Create the Bottom Layer
Pour grenadine syrup slowly into the bottom of two tall clear glasses so it settles at the very bottom without mixing.
Step 2: Add the Middle Layer
Mix white grape juice with blue food coloring and slowly pour it over the back of a spoon into each glass so it floats above the grenadine layer.
Step 3: Top with Soda and Watch
Gently pour lemon-lime soda down the side of the glass to create the top layer and watch the lava lamp bubbling effect begin as the carbonation moves the layers.
Easy substitutions
Missing an ingredient? Here are some swaps that work perfectly:
- white grape juice → clear apple juice
- grenadine syrup → pomegranate juice for a natural alternative
Common mistakes to avoid
Watch out for these pitfalls that can affect your results:
- Pouring layers too quickly causes them to blend together and ruins the lava lamp layered effect
- Skipping the back-of-spoon technique for pouring makes layers merge instead of staying separated
